


WWE wrestler and actor Kaori Housako, better known as Kairi Sane, initially represented Japanese women’s wrestling promotion Stardom, as Kairi Hojo, and also won many honors, such as the Artist of Stardom. She is also skilled in yachting, holds a degree in Japanese literature, and has taught Japanese in Cambodia.

Hiroshi Tanahashi is a Japanese professional wrestler, widely regarded as one of the greatest professional wrestlers of all time. He is the current NEVER Openweight Champion at New Japan Pro-Wrestling (NJPW). He is one of the most decorated wrestlers in New Japan's history with eight reigns as IWGP Heavyweight Champion and three reigns as IWGP Tag Team Champion.





Jushin Thunder Liger is a Japanese retired wrestler and mixed martial artist. He is best known for his association with New Japan Pro-Wrestling (NJPW) where he was an important wrestler from 1984 to 2020. He was also popular in America's WWE stable and was inducted into the WWE Hall of Fame in 2020.















Killer Khan is a Japanese former professional wrestler best known for appearing alongside wrestlers like André the Giant in several high-profile matches during the 1980s in the World Wrestling Federation (WWF). Khan also took part in Canada's Stampede Wrestling where he was the Stampede North American Heavyweight Champion for a couple of months.











Retired wrestler Hiroshi Hase is also a former world champion. Initially a high-school teacher of Japanese literature, Hase later stepped into wrestling and even represented Japan at the 1984 Summer Olympics. He has also been a cabinet minister under Shinzō Abe and now represents Ishikawa in the National Diet.
